diff --git a/AGENTS.md b/AGENTS.md index 4b6e18f7..6539b173 100644 --- a/AGENTS.md +++ b/AGENTS.md @@ -137,6 +137,10 @@ gh pr merge --squash --delete-branch pnpm agent worktree delete ``` +合并门禁(必须执行): +- **在合并之前必须询问用户**,并明确告知当前工作目录(worktree 路径)。 +- 用户 review 确认后才允许执行合并。 + --- ## 重要提醒 diff --git a/CLAUDE.md b/CLAUDE.md index 0de4d3ef..d5721de5 100644 --- a/CLAUDE.md +++ b/CLAUDE.md @@ -81,5 +81,6 @@ gh pr create --body "Closes #28" - 所有业务逻辑必须有单元测试 - 使用 TypeScript 严格模式 - PR 描述使用 `Closes #issue编号` 自动关联任务 +- 合并前必须告知当前 worktree 路径并征求用户确认 diff --git a/scripts/agent/readme.ts b/scripts/agent/readme.ts index 7cec6347..92c044fe 100644 --- a/scripts/agent/readme.ts +++ b/scripts/agent/readme.ts @@ -91,6 +91,7 @@ pnpm agent worktree list worktree 概览 pnpm agent worktree delete [--force] PR 规则: 描述中使用 Closes #issue编号 自动关联 +合并门禁: 合并前必须告知当前 worktree 路径并征求用户确认 `) }